The CHUP Library and Documentation Department (SBD) was established in February 1928 under the designation Central Library of Hospital de Santo António (HSA). From 2007 onwards, after the merging of the hospitals and the establishment of Centro Hospitalar do Porto, Central Library of HAS has also integrated the collections from Hospital Maria Pia, Maternidade Júlio Dinis, and Hospital Joaquim Urbano libraries. The Library is located on Level 0 – Central Wing – of the Neoclassic Building of HAS, which is a National Monument since 1910. Integrated at DEFI, the Library works as a support unit within the institutional operational structure and cooperates with CHUP Museum for reception and surveillance purposes.
The Library’s mission is to warrant access to relevant and up-to-date information to the entire CHUP staff, supporting its professional activities and hence ensuring the quality of health care provided, and supporting teaching, training, and research activities. The Library’s main goals and competences are to secure an efficient management and organization of the documentary collection, through the use of information technologies and methods universally used by Library Science; to propose the selection and acquisition of bibliographic resources, contributing to the maintenance of quality information sources, as well as the optimization of services provided; to disseminate the Library resources and their accessibility; to support the users, guiding and training them towards an efficient resource use and optimal bibliographic search; and to cooperate with national and international organisms and similar documentation services.
SBD has a printed collection with more than 700 journal titles, around 3000 books and monographs, and a rare collection of Medicine and Nursing documents termed ‘Reserved’, which belong to the Historic Fund. Over the last decade, SBD has also taken responsibility as a “Digital Library”, as other, mostly electronic/online, bibliographic resources have been included; the electronic catalogue offers several open access information sources and, among others, more than 4000 scientific journals (ejournals), over 1200 electronic books (ebooks), and multimedia resources (several thousands of pictures and several hundreds of videos), individually subscribed or included in full-text databases, which can be assessed through the platform’s search engine, also known as Digital Library of CHUP.
